Job Description – Bathroom Fitter (Social Housing)
Position: Bathroom Fitter
Location: Bedfordshire and Surrounding Areas
Employment Type: Permanent, Full-Time
Salary: £38,610 per annum
Benefits: Company Van and Fuel Card Provided
About the Role
Fortus Recruitment are currently recruting for a Bathroom fitter to join a well established Social Housing Contrcator. This is a permanent position offering long-term stability, a competitive salary, and a fully equipped company van with fuel card. The successful candidate will be responsible for carrying out complete bathroom installations and associated works to a high standard while maintaining excellent customer service for residents.
Key Responsibilities
Complete full bathroom refurbishments within occupied and void social housing properties.
Remove existing bathroom suites and prepare areas for installation.
Install baths, showers, shower trays, WC's, basins, vanity units, and associated fixtures.
Carry out wall and floor tiling, boxing-in, and finishing works.
Undertake basic plumbing alterations and repairs as required.
Complete minor carpentry works, including fitting bath panels, boxing, and trims.
Ensure all work is completed in accordance with company standards, health and safety regulations, and project specifications.
Maintain accurate records of work completed using company systems or paperwork.
Communicate professionally and courteously with tenants, residents, and colleagues.
Keep company vehicle clean, organised, and stocked with required materials and tools.
Requirements
Essential
Proven experience as a Bathroom Fitter within social housing, domestic maintenance, or refurbishment environments.
Strong skills in bathroom installation, plumbing, tiling, and basic carpentry.
Ability to work independently and manage workload effectively.
Good problem-solving skills and attention to detail.
Excellent customer service and communication skills.
Full UK Driving Licence.
Understanding of health and safety requirements within residential properties.
Desirable
Experience working in occupied social housing properties.
Multi-skilled background in additional trades.
Asbestos Awareness certification.
CSCS Card.
What We Offer
Permanent employment with a well-established organisation.
Competitive salary of £38,610 per annum.
Company van provided for business use.
Fuel card supplied.
Ongoing work across Bedfordshire and surrounding areas.
Opportunities for training and career development.
Company pension scheme.
Paid annual leave.
Supportive team environment.
Working Hours
Monday to Friday
Full-time, permanent position
Overtime opportunities may be available
